Thanks again, Marc -----Original Message----- From: Steven A Rowe [mailto:sar...@syr.edu] Sent: 09 September 2011 14:40 To: solr-user@lucene.apache.org Subject: RE: question about StandardAnalyzer, differences between solr 1.4 and solr 3.3 Hi Marc, StandardAnalyzer includes StopFilter. See the Javadocs for Lucene 3.3 here: <http://lucene.apache.org/java/3_3_0/api/all/org/apache/lucene/analysis/standard/StandardAnalyzer.html> This is not new behavior - StandardAnalyzer in Lucene 2.9.1 (the version of Lucene bundled with Solr 1.4) also includes a StopFilter: <http://lucene.apache.org/java/2_9_1/api/all/org/apache/lucene/analysis/standard/StandardAnalyzer.html> If you don't want a StopFilter configured, you can specify the individual components directly, e.g. to get the equivalent of StandardAnalyzer, but without the StopFilter: <fieldtype name="text" class="solr.TextField"> <analyzer> <tokenizer class="solr.StandardTokenizerFactory"/> <filter class="solr.StandardFilterFactory"/> <filter class="solr.LowerCaseFilterFactory"/> </analyzer> </fieldtype> Steve > -----Original Message----- > From: Marc Des Garets [mailto:marc.desgar...@192.com] > Sent: Friday, September 09, 2011 6:21 AM > To: solr-user@lucene.apache.org > Subject: question about StandardAnalyzer, differences between solr 1.4 > and solr 3.3 > > Hi, > > I have a simple field defined like this: > <fieldtype name="text" class="solr.TextField"> > <analyzer > class="org.apache.lucene.analysis.standard.StandardAnalyzer"/> > </fieldtype> > > Which I use here: > <field name="middlename" type="text" indexed="true" stored="true" > required="false" /> > > In solr 1.4, I could do: > ?q=(middlename:a*) > > And I was getting all documents where middlename = A or where middlename > starts by the letter A. > > In solr 3.3, I get only results where middlename starts by the letter A > but not where middlename is equal to A. > > The thing is this happens only with the letter A, with other letters, it > is fine, I get the ones starting by the letter and the ones equal to the > letter. My guess is that it considers A as the English article but I do > not specify any filter with stopwords so how come the behaviour with the > letter A is different from the other letters? Is there a bug? How can I > change my field to work with the letter A, the same way it does with > other letters. > > > Thanks, > Marc > ---------------------------------------------------------- > This transmission is strictly confidential, possibly legally privileged, > and intended solely for the > addressee.
